Stay away from platinum and stick to copper (Bosch if you can find it). There is a bit of controversy on this, but, by far, copper is what most people recommend. Also, make sure you are getinng non-resistor plugs. Last time I got some they tried to convince me that resistor plugs are ok. Don't buy it.
